    Strawberry Spinach Salad Breakfast Wrap
    Prep: 10 min Cook: 5 min Servings: 2

    This Strawberry Spinach Breakfast Wrap is a yummy, quick, deliciously reFRESHing, packed full of nutrients morning meal. Perfect healthy alternative!

    Ingredients

    • 2 strips turkey bacon (or real bacon if you live dangerously like me), cooked and crumbled
    • ¼ cup walnuts pieces
    • ¼ pound strawberries
    • 1 teaspoon coconut sugar (they have this at Trader Joe’s)
    • 2 tablespoons nonfat Greek yogurt
    • ½ teaspoon honey
    • 1 teaspoon fresh lime juice
    • 1 large multi grain wrap (or lavash flatbread)
    • ¾ cup fresh spinach
    • 2 teaspoons chia seeds

    Directions

    1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Spread the walnuts on a small baking sheet and roast for 5-8 minutes, tossing a couple times to ensure evening cooking. Set aside to cool.
    2. Remove the green hulls and slice the strawberries into ¼ inch slices. Place them in a small bowl and stir in the coconut sugar. Let stand for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
    3. In a small bowl, mix together the yogurt, honey and lime to make a dressing.
    4. When ready to assemble, spread the dressing over the wrap. Top with the spinach, strawberries, bacon, walnuts and chia seeds. Roll up the wrap and cut in half. Enjoy IMMEDIATELY!
